WebSep 28, 2024 · Andalusia. Andalusia is the largest autonomous community in Spain based on population and it is home to about 8.4 million residents which translate to about 17.84% of Spain’s total population. With over 46 million people in total, Spain has many lovely cities and tourist destinations. simplity fe hubWeb2 days ago · Spain, country located in extreme southwestern Europe. It occupies about 85 percent of the Iberian Peninsula, which it shares with its smaller neighbour Portugal.
